10. Abide with Me; 'Tis Eventide

1 Abide with me; 'tis eventide.
The day is past and gone;
The shadows of the evening fall;
The night is coming on.
Within my heart a welcome guest,
Within my home abide.

Refrain:
O Savior, stay this night with me;
Behold, 'tis eventide!
O Savior, stay this night with me;
Behold, 'tis eventide.

2 Abide with me; 'tis eventide.
Thy walk today with me
Has made my heart within me burn,
As I communed with Thee.
Thy earnest words have filled my soul
And kept me near Thy side. [Refrain]

3 Abide with me; 'tis eventide,
And lone will be the night
If I cannot commune with Thee,
Nor find in Thee my light.
The darkness of the world, I fear,
Would in my home abide. [Refrain]

Text Information
First Line: Abide with me; 'tis eventide
Title: Abide with Me; 'Tis Eventide
Author: Martin Lowrie Hofford (1884)
Language: English
Publication Date: 1997
Topic: Closing Hymns
Tune Information
Name: [Abide with me; 'tis eventide]
Composer: Harrison Millard (1884)
Key: E♭ Major
